Gambling911.com will reluctantly take the Jets +10 while that number is still available for our Jets-Patriots free pick.  The betting line opened at -9.5 New England, moved up a half point at most books, and was beginning to come back down to the -9.5.

The books want money on New England with the Patriots seeing 65% of the bets.  That’s a solid number for a lone Thursday Night Football game.

New York is dreadful this season with a quarterback issue that simply cannot be resolved until next year.  Even so, the Jets have had issues at other positions as well. 

While their 1-5 Straight Up start may seem bad, it actually could be worse and is.  Against The Spread they have had zero victories this season.

Of the last four games in this series, three have been won by a field goal.  New York is 1-3 over that time. 

It’s interesting to note that the Patriots are just 1-7 ATS in their last 8 games after allowing more than 250 yards passing in their previous game.
